addArc(REAL *, Quilt *, long) | Subdivider | |
addArc(int, TrimVertex *, long) | Subdivider | |
addQuilt(Quilt *) | Subdivider | |
arc_split(Arc_ptr, int, REAL, int) | Subdivider | private |
arcpool | Subdivider | private |
arctessellator | Subdivider | private |
backend | Subdivider | private |
bbox(TrimVertex *, TrimVertex *, TrimVertex *, int) | Subdivider | inlineprivate |
bbox(REAL, REAL, REAL, REAL, REAL, REAL) | Subdivider | privatestatic |
beginLoop(void) | Subdivider | inline |
beginQuilts(void) | Subdivider | |
beginTrims(void) | Subdivider | inline |
bezierarcpool | Subdivider | private |
ccw(TrimVertex *, TrimVertex *, TrimVertex *) | Subdivider | privatestatic |
ccwTurn_sl(Arc_ptr, Arc_ptr) | Subdivider | |
ccwTurn_sr(Arc_ptr, Arc_ptr) | Subdivider | |
ccwTurn_tl(Arc_ptr, Arc_ptr) | Subdivider | |
ccwTurn_tr(Arc_ptr, Arc_ptr) | Subdivider | |
check_s(Arc_ptr, Arc_ptr) | Subdivider | private |
check_t(Arc_ptr, Arc_ptr) | Subdivider | private |
classify_headonleft_s(Bin &, Bin &, Bin &, REAL) | Subdivider | private |
classify_headonleft_t(Bin &, Bin &, Bin &, REAL) | Subdivider | private |
classify_headonright_s(Bin &, Bin &, Bin &, REAL) | Subdivider | private |
classify_headonright_t(Bin &, Bin &, Bin &, REAL) | Subdivider | private |
classify_tailonleft_s(Bin &, Bin &, Bin &, REAL) | Subdivider | private |
classify_tailonleft_t(Bin &, Bin &, Bin &, REAL) | Subdivider | private |
classify_tailonright_s(Bin &, Bin &, Bin &, REAL) | Subdivider | private |
classify_tailonright_t(Bin &, Bin &, Bin &, REAL) | Subdivider | private |
clear(void) | Subdivider | |
decompose(Bin &, REAL) | Subdivider | private |
dir enum name | Subdivider | private |
domain_distance_u_rate | Subdivider | private |
domain_distance_v_rate | Subdivider | private |
down enum value | Subdivider | private |
drawCurves(void) | Subdivider | |
drawSurfaces(long) | Subdivider | |
endLoop(void) | Subdivider | inline |
endQuilts(void) | Subdivider | inline |
endTrims(void) | Subdivider | inline |
findIrregularS(Bin &) | Subdivider | private |
findIrregularT(Bin &) | Subdivider | private |
freejarcs(Bin &) | Subdivider | private |
initialbin | Subdivider | private |
is_domain_distance_sampling | Subdivider | private |
isArcTypeBezier | Subdivider | private |
isBezierArcType(void) | Subdivider | inlineprivate |
isMonotone(Arc_ptr) | Subdivider | private |
join_s(Bin &, Bin &, Arc_ptr, Arc_ptr) | Subdivider | private |
join_t(Bin &, Bin &, Arc_ptr, Arc_ptr) | Subdivider | private |
jumpbuffer | Subdivider | private |
link(Arc_ptr, Arc_ptr, Arc_ptr, Arc_ptr) | Subdivider | inlineprivate |
makeBorderTrim(const REAL *, const REAL *) | Subdivider | private |
makePatchBoundary(const REAL *from, const REAL *to) | Subdivider | private |
monosplitInS(Bin &, int, int) | Subdivider | private |
monosplitInT(Bin &, int, int) | Subdivider | private |
monotonize(Arc_ptr, Bin &) | Subdivider | private |
none enum value | Subdivider | private |
nonSamplingSplit(Bin &, Patchlist &, int, int) | Subdivider | private |
outline(Bin &) | Subdivider | private |
partition(Bin &, Bin &, Bin &, Bin &, Bin &, int, REAL) | Subdivider | private |
pjarc | Subdivider | private |
pwlarcpool | Subdivider | private |
qlist | Subdivider | private |
render(Bin &) | Subdivider | private |
renderhints | Subdivider | private |
s_index | Subdivider | private |
same enum value | Subdivider | private |
samplingSplit(Curvelist &, int) | Subdivider | private |
samplingSplit(Bin &, Patchlist &, int, int) | Subdivider | private |
set_domain_distance_u_rate(REAL u_rate) | Subdivider | inline |
set_domain_distance_v_rate(REAL v_rate) | Subdivider | inline |
set_is_domain_distance_sampling(int flag) | Subdivider | inline |
setArcTypeBezier(void) | Subdivider | inlineprivate |
setArcTypePwl(void) | Subdivider | inlineprivate |
setDegenerate(void) | Subdivider | inlineprivate |
setJumpbuffer(JumpBuffer *) | Subdivider | |
setNonDegenerate(void) | Subdivider | inlineprivate |
showDegenerate | Subdivider | private |
showingDegenerate(void) | Subdivider | inlineprivate |
simple_link(Arc_ptr, Arc_ptr) | Subdivider | inlineprivate |
slicer | Subdivider | private |
smbrkpts | Subdivider | private |
spbrkpts | Subdivider | private |
split(Bin &, Bin &, Bin &, int, REAL) | Subdivider | private |
split(Bin &, int, const REAL *, int, int) | Subdivider | private |
splitInS(Bin &, int, int) | Subdivider | private |
splitInT(Bin &, int, int) | Subdivider | private |
stepsizes | Subdivider | private |
subdivideInS(Bin &) | Subdivider | private |
Subdivider(Renderhints &, Backend &) | Subdivider | |
t_index | Subdivider | private |
tessellate(Arc_ptr, REAL) | Subdivider | private |
tessellate(Bin &, REAL, REAL, REAL, REAL) | Subdivider | private |
tessellation(Bin &, Patchlist &) | Subdivider | private |
tmbrkpts | Subdivider | private |
tpbrkpts | Subdivider | private |
trimvertexpool | Subdivider | private |
up enum value | Subdivider | private |
~Subdivider(void) | Subdivider | |